APPEALS

 

 

     

Practice Areas

 

Our firm has several litigators skilled in appellate practice.  An adverse decision from a trial court can be appealed to the Wisconsin Court of Appeals.  There are four appellate districts in the state.  Appellate practice involves intense research and preparation of written argument which is governed by strict timelines.  Subsequent to a decision from the Court of Appeals, a matter may be pursued to the Wisconsin Supreme Court.  This Court only takes very select cases and a review by the Supreme Court is not guaranteed.  The appellate process is lengthy, in that, many cases will take years before they are finally decided by a higher court.  If you are considering appealing an adverse decision of a trial court, it is imperative to contact counsel as soon as possible so that appropriate deadlines are met and your rights are preserved.
